Smoke from Canadian wildfires shrouded New York in a record-breaking apocalyptic smog on Wednesday as cities along the United States’ East Coast issued air quality alerts and thousands evacuated their homes in Canada.

The Big Apple’s mayor urged residents to stay indoors as the thick haze of pollution cast an eerie yellowish glow over Manhattan’s famous skyscrapers, delayed flights and forced the postponement of sporting events.
